本発明は、隣接するサッシ枠の縦枠同士を方立で連結した建具に関する。   The present invention relates to a joinery in which vertical frames of adjacent sash frames are connected in a vertical manner.

ビル等の窓では、複数の窓枠の縦枠同士を方立で連結し、連窓としたものがある。このような窓では、火災時に縦枠や方立が火災の熱で変形したり溶融したりするのに伴って、縦枠と方立との間に隙間ができ、その隙間を通じて火炎や煙等が室内外を連通するおそれがある。   Some windows of buildings and the like have a plurality of window frames vertically connected to form a continuous window. In such a window, there is a gap between the vertical frame and the vertical frame as the vertical frame and vertical frame are deformed or melted by the heat of the fire in the event of a fire. May communicate indoors and outdoors.

本発明は以上に述べた実情に鑑み、縦枠同士を方立で連結した建具の防火性能の向上を目的とする。   The present invention has been made in view of the above-described circumstances, and an object thereof is to improve the fire prevention performance of a joinery in which vertical frames are connected in a vertical manner.

上記の課題を達成するために請求項1記載の発明による建具は、サッシ枠と、サッシ枠の縦枠同士を連結する方立とを備え、縦枠と方立とは、互いに係合する爪を有し、縦枠が方立に係合しており、方立と縦枠の間には、縦枠が方立との係合が解除する方向に移動するのを長手方向で規制する金属製の開き防止具が設けてあり、開き防止具は、方立の略全長に亘って配置してあり、見込壁と見込壁を支持する支持脚を有することを特徴とする。 In order to achieve the above object, a joinery according to the first aspect of the present invention includes a sash frame and a vertical connecting the vertical frames of the sash frame, and the vertical frame and the vertical nail engage with each other. The vertical frame is engaged in a vertical direction, and the metal that restricts the vertical frame from moving in the longitudinal direction between the vertical frame and the vertical frame is released in the direction in which the vertical frame is released. An anti-opening device made of metal is provided, and the anti-opening device is arranged over substantially the entire length of the vertical and has a support wall for supporting the anticipation wall and the anticipation wall.

請求項1記載の発明による建具は、縦枠と方立とは、互いに係合する爪を有し、縦枠が方立に係合しており、方立と縦枠の間には、縦枠が方立との係合が解除する方向に移動するのを長手方向で規制する金属製の開き防止具が方立の略全長に亘って設けてあることで、火災時に縦枠と方立間の隙間の発生を抑制し、火炎や煙の連通を防止できるので、防火性能が向上する。開き防止具は、見込壁と見込壁を支持する支持脚を有することで、開き防止具が取付けしやすい上に、開き防止具の取付強度を増すことができる。 In the fitting according to the first aspect of the present invention, the vertical frame and the vertical frame have claws that engage with each other, and the vertical frame is engaged in the vertical direction. by frame is metal opening prevention tool for regulating the movement in a direction to release the engagement between the mullions in the longitudinal direction is provided over substantially the entire length of the mullion, the vertical frame and Kataritsu a fire Since the generation of gaps between them can be suppressed and communication of flames and smoke can be prevented, the fireproof performance is improved. By providing the anti-opening device with the anticipation wall and the supporting leg that supports the anticipation wall, the anti-opening device can be easily attached and the attachment strength of the anti-opening device can be increased.

以下、本発明の実施の形態を図面に基づいて説明する。図1,4は、本発明の建具の第1実施形態を示している。この建具は、ビルの窓に用いられるものであって、図4に示すように、左右に隣接して配置されたサッシ枠1,1の縦枠2,2同士を方立3で連結し、連窓にしたものである。
各サッシ枠1には、図1に示すように、室内側から複層ガラス11を嵌め込み、室内側に押縁12を取付け、サッシ枠1の室外側のガラス保持片13及び室内側の押縁12と複層ガラス11との間に、バックアップ材14とシール材15を装填して複層ガラス11を固定してあり、いわゆる嵌め殺し窓となっている。
サッシ枠1の縦枠2は、アルミニウム合金の押出形材よりなり、図1に示すように、外周側が開放した略コ字状断面となっており、縦枠2の室外側縁部16は室内側に向けて鉤状に曲がった形に形成され、縦枠2の室内側縁部17は室外側に向けて鉤状に曲がった形に形成されている。
Hereinafter, embodiments of the present invention will be described with reference to the drawings. 1 and 4 show a first embodiment of the joinery of the present invention. This joinery is used for building windows, and as shown in FIG. 4, the vertical frames 2, 2 of the sash frames 1, 1 arranged adjacent to each other on the left and right sides are connected by a stand 3, It is a continuous window.
As shown in FIG. 1, a multi-layer glass 11 is fitted into each sash frame 1 from the indoor side, and a pressing edge 12 is attached to the indoor side. A back-up material 14 and a sealing material 15 are loaded between the multi-layer glass 11 to fix the multi-layer glass 11, which is a so-called fitting window.
The vertical frame 2 of the sash frame 1 is made of an aluminum alloy extruded shape, and has a substantially U-shaped cross section with the outer peripheral side open as shown in FIG. The interior side edge 17 of the vertical frame 2 is formed in a shape bent in a bowl shape toward the outdoor side.

方立3は、図1に示すように、方立本体23と目板5と目板カバー24とで構成されている。方立本体23は、アルミニウム合金の押出形材よりなり、室外側及び室内側の見付壁19,20と一対の見込み壁21,21とからなる見込み方向に長い矩形断面の中空部22を有している。室外側の見付壁19は、見込み壁21,21よりも側方に張り出している。一対の見込み壁21,21の室外側寄りの位置には、室外側に向けて鉤状に曲がった爪6が長手方向に沿って設けてある。また、一対の見込み壁21,21の室内側端部寄りの位置には、突部7が長手方向に沿って設けてある。突部7の先端部には、縦枠2の室内側縁部17が係止する係止部25を有する。方立本体23の室内側面26は、フラットに形成されている。
目板5は、方立3の略全長に亘って設けられるものであって、アルミニウム合金の押出形材よりなり、方立本体23の室内側の見付壁20と略同じ横幅を有する取付板部27と、取付板部27の左右端部より室内側に若干オフセットして側方にのびる縦枠支持部34,34とを有し、左右の縦枠2,2及び方立本体23の室内側面に跨って配置してある。目板5は、全体が方立本体23より肉厚に形成してある。取付板部27は、室外側面28がフラットになっており、この面28を方立本体23の室内側面26と面接触させ、室内側からのネジ29で固定してある。
目板カバー24は、アルミ又は樹脂の押出形材よりなり、室外側が開放した略コ字状断面に形成され、左右の側壁に形成された係止部30,30を目板5の側縁部に室内側から弾発的に係止させて取付けられ、目板5を室内側から被っている。
As shown in FIG. 1, the vertical 3 includes a vertical main body 23, the eye plate 5, and the eye plate cover 24. The vertical body 23 is made of an aluminum alloy extruded shape, and has a hollow portion 22 having a rectangular cross section that is long in the prospective direction and includes a pair of prospective walls 21 and 21 on the outdoor and indoor sides. doing. The outdoor-side finding wall 19 projects laterally from the prospective walls 21 and 21. Claws 6 bent in a bowl shape toward the outdoor side are provided along the longitudinal direction at positions closer to the outdoor side of the pair of prospective walls 21 and 21. Moreover, the protrusion 7 is provided in the position near the indoor side edge part of a pair of prospective walls 21 and 21 along the longitudinal direction. At the tip of the protrusion 7, there is a locking portion 25 that locks the indoor side edge 17 of the vertical frame 2. The indoor side surface 26 of the vertical body 23 is formed flat.
The face plate 5 is provided over substantially the entire length of the vertical 3 and is made of an aluminum alloy extruded shape, and has a lateral width that is substantially the same as that of the inner wall 20 of the vertical main body 23. Portion 27 and vertical frame support portions 34, 34 that are slightly offset toward the indoor side from the left and right ends of the mounting plate portion 27, and extend in the lateral direction. It is arranged across the side. The entire face plate 5 is formed thicker than the vertical body 23. The mounting plate portion 27 has a flat outdoor side surface 28, which is in surface contact with the indoor side surface 26 of the vertical body 23 and fixed with screws 29 from the indoor side.
The eye plate cover 24 is made of an extruded shape of aluminum or resin, is formed in a substantially U-shaped cross section with the outdoor side open, and the locking portions 30, 30 formed on the left and right side walls are connected to the side edges of the eye plate 5. It is fixedly attached to the section from the indoor side and covers the eye plate 5 from the indoor side.

縦枠2は、図1に示すように、室外側縁部16が方立本体23の見込み壁21に形成された爪6に室外側から係合している。方立本体23の見込み壁21の室外側端部には、金属製の断面コ字状の長尺材よりなる開き防止具4が長手方向の略全長に亘って配置してある。この開き防止具4は、方立本体23の室外側の見付壁19の張り出し部分19aと縦枠2の室外側面間の隙間に、当て木を当てて打ち込んで取付けてあり、方立本体23の室外側の見付壁19の張り出し部分19aと縦枠2の室外側面との間に介在している。この開き防止具4がクサビとなり、縦枠2が方立本体23との係合が解除する方向(室外側)に移動するのを長手方向で規制している。さらに、方立本体23の室外側の見付壁19の張り出し部分19aと縦枠2の室外側面との間には、耐火性のバックアップ材32を挿入した上でシール材33を充填し、雨水の浸入を防いでいる。縦枠2の室内側縁部17は、方立本体23の見込み壁21に長手方向に設けた突部7と目板5の縦枠支持部34とで挟み込まれている。   As shown in FIG. 1, the vertical frame 2 has the outdoor side edge portion 16 engaged with the claw 6 formed on the prospective wall 21 of the vertical body 23 from the outdoor side. At the outdoor side end portion of the prospective wall 21 of the vertical body 23, an opening prevention tool 4 made of a long material having a U-shaped cross section made of metal is disposed over substantially the entire length in the longitudinal direction. The opening preventer 4 is attached by striking a batting pad into the gap between the protruding portion 19a of the outside wall 19 of the vertical body 23 and the outdoor side surface of the vertical frame 2. It is interposed between the overhanging portion 19a of the outside-side finding wall 19 and the outdoor side surface of the vertical frame 2. This opening prevention tool 4 becomes a wedge and restricts the longitudinal frame 2 from moving in the direction in which the engagement with the vertical body 23 is released (outdoor). Further, between the projecting portion 19a of the outside wall 19 of the vertical body 23 and the outdoor side surface of the vertical frame 2, a fire-resistant backup material 32 is inserted and then a sealing material 33 is filled. To prevent the intrusion. The indoor side edge 17 of the vertical frame 2 is sandwiched between the projection 7 provided in the longitudinal direction on the prospective wall 21 of the vertical body 23 and the vertical frame support 34 of the eye plate 5.

以上に述べたように本実施形態の建具は、縦枠2の室外側縁部16が方立本体23の爪6に室外側から係合し、方立本体23の見込み壁21に縦枠2が方立本体23との係合が解除する方向(室外側)に移動するのを長手方向で規制する開き防止具4が設けてあることで、火災時に縦枠2と方立3間の隙間の発生を抑制し、火炎や煙の連通を防止できるので、防火性能が向上する。
本実施形態によれば、開き防止具4を方立本体23にネジ止めする必要がないため、施工性が向上する。また開き防止具4は、方立3と縦枠2間に隙間なく嵌め込んだだけでネジ止めしてないので、方立3や縦枠2が熱伸びしたときに熱伸びを吸収することができ、開き防止具4と方立3及び縦枠2間に隙間が生ずるのを防止できる。
As described above, in the joinery of this embodiment, the outdoor side edge 16 of the vertical frame 2 is engaged with the claw 6 of the vertical body 23 from the outdoor side, and the vertical frame 2 is attached to the prospective wall 21 of the vertical body 23. Is provided with an opening preventer 4 that restricts movement in the longitudinal direction to disengage the engagement with the vertical body 23 (outdoor), so that a gap between the vertical frame 2 and the vertical 3 in the event of a fire. The fire prevention performance is improved by suppressing the occurrence of fire and preventing the communication of flame and smoke.
According to this embodiment, since it is not necessary to screw the opening preventer 4 to the vertical body 23, workability is improved. Further, since the opening preventer 4 is fitted with no gap between the vertical 3 and the vertical frame 2 and is not screwed, it can absorb the thermal expansion when the vertical 3 or the vertical frame 2 is thermally expanded. It is possible to prevent a gap from being generated between the opening preventer 4 and the vertical 3 and the vertical frame 2.

また本実施形態の建具は、縦枠2が方立3と係合しており、目板5は、方立3の略全長に亘って設けてあり、左右の縦枠2,2及び方立3(方立本体23)の室内側面に跨って配置してあり、方立3の突部7と目板5とで縦枠2の室内側縁部17を挟み込んでいることで、縦枠2が見込み方向に移動して方立本体23との係合が外れるのをより一層確実に防止できると共に、縦枠2の室内側縁部17と方立3間に隙間が開くことも防止できるため、縦枠2と方立3間からの火炎や煙の連通を防止し、防火性能を向上できる。
また、方立本体23の室内側面26と目板5の室外側面28とが面接触していることで、火災時に目板5が熱せられたときに熱を方立3側に効率よく逃がすことができるため、目板5の溶融や変形を抑えられる。
In the joinery of the present embodiment, the vertical frame 2 is engaged with the vertical 3, and the eye plate 5 is provided over substantially the entire length of the vertical 3, and the left and right vertical frames 2, 2 and the vertical 3 (vertical body 23) is disposed across the indoor side surface, and the vertical frame 2 is formed by sandwiching the indoor side edge 17 of the vertical frame 2 between the protrusion 7 and the eye plate 5 of the vertical 3. Can be more reliably prevented from moving in the expected direction and disengaged from the vertical body 23, and a gap can be prevented from opening between the indoor side edge 17 of the vertical frame 2 and the vertical 3. It is possible to prevent the flame and smoke from communicating between the vertical frame 2 and the vertical 3 and improve the fire prevention performance.
Further, since the indoor side surface 26 of the vertical body 23 and the outdoor side surface 28 of the eye plate 5 are in surface contact, when the eye plate 5 is heated in the event of a fire, heat can be efficiently released to the side 3 side. Therefore, melting and deformation of the eye plate 5 can be suppressed.
